Retro Replay Review

Gameplay

Sensible Soccer ’98 retains the lightning-fast, arcade-style mechanics that made the series a household name during the early 1990s. As both player and coach, you’ll experience a seamless blend of strategic overhead play and pick-up-and-play immediacy. Passing, shooting, and tackling all feel deliberately responsive, giving you just enough control to pull off slick one-twos or last-ditch defensive blocks.

One of the standout features is the variety of competition modes. Beyond the preset World Championship that mirrors the real 1998 World Cup, you can jump right into quick three-on-three arcade matches or craft deep, multi-stage leagues. The coach mode offers an additional layer of strategic depth, allowing you to tweak formations, substitutions, and tactical instructions between rounds.

Creating custom teams adds a level of personalization rarely seen in other titles of the era. You can assemble a dream lineup, assign kits and crests, and then watch your creations come alive on the pitch. This DIY approach keeps replay value high, as you’ll spend hours perfecting both your own squad and your in-game coaching strategies.

Graphics

At first glance, the shift from the classic 2D sprites to a fully 3D engine is immediately noticeable. Player models are blockier than modern standards, but they move fluidly across the field, giving matches a sense of depth that was previously absent. Stadiums now feel more alive, with stands that curve realistically and pitch surfaces that respond to in-game weather conditions.

The camera angles are adjustable, allowing you to choose between a traditional top-down view or a more dynamic side-on perspective. Both options have their merits: the overhead angle preserves the classic Sensible feel, while the angled view enhances immersion by putting you closer to the action. Animations—such as sliding tackles and goal celebrations—are basic by today’s measures but still radiate charm and personality.

Menus and HUD elements have received a facelift, blending crisp text and clean icons with subtle animations. Navigating team lineups, competition brackets, and custom team creation screens is quick and intuitive. While the graphics won’t rival contemporary AAA sports titles, the updated visuals successfully modernize a beloved classic without losing its original spirit.

Story

As a football simulation, Sensible Soccer ’98 doesn’t deliver a traditional narrative. Instead, its “story” unfolds through the competitive journey you choose—be it a quick arcade romp or a full-blown World Championship campaign. Each match writes its own storyline, driven by your tactical decisions, key goals, and dramatic comebacks.

The preset World Championship mode loosely mirrors the real-life drama of the 1998 World Cup, offering a familiar progression through group stages, knockout rounds, and a climactic final. Although the game doesn’t feature licensed team names or player likenesses, it captures the tournament’s atmosphere with authentic jerseys and stadium backdrops reminiscent of France 1998.

For those seeking a more personalized tale, the custom competitions and team creation tools essentially turn Sensible Soccer ’98 into a sandbox. Design your own league, draft players with unique stats, and build a backstory for your side. The lack of a rigid storyline might put off narrative-driven gamers, but it opens up limitless possibilities for soccer enthusiasts who prefer to write their own sporting saga.

Overall Experience

Sensible Soccer ’98 masterfully bridges the gap between nostalgic simplicity and modern sports gaming expectations. The core gameplay remains instantly accessible, yet layers of depth keep veterans engaged match after match. Whether you’re sprinting down the wing as a player or orchestrating tactics as a coach, the game delivers a consistently satisfying football experience.

The visual upgrade to 3D, while modest by today’s standards, injects fresh life into the franchise’s trademark aesthetic. Combined with a straightforward menu system and customizable options, the presentation feels polished without sacrificing the series’ beloved pick-up-and-play nature. Audio cues—from referee whistles to crowd chants—further enhance the immersion without ever becoming intrusive.

For potential buyers, Sensible Soccer ’98 offers a unique blend of arcade fun and managerial depth at an affordable price point. It may not boast the official licenses or hyper-realistic graphics of some contemporaries, but its enduring gameplay mechanics and robust customization features make it a standout choice for soccer fans looking for fast, fun, and flexible football action.
